Green roof systems can be shallow typically referred to as extensive or deep typically referred to as intensive.
The design of the different drainage layers allows for a portion of the stormwater to be retained above where the water is allowed to flow freely off of the roof.
For flat or nearly flat roofs primary drains are located at the lowest point of the roof.
Green roofs comprise a multi layered system that covers the roof of a building or podium structure with vegetation cover landscaping.
